Why Tind Bans Accounts and Why It Feels Unfair

Accounts are commonly banned for harassment, hate speech, offensive language, sexual photos, violent content, impersonation, or catfishing.

Tind makes decisions based on Terms of Use and Community Guidelines. What many do not realize is that even harmless actions can trigger bans:

  • Handles in your bio (Instagram, email, number, etc.) 
  • Spam-like behavior, 
  • Soliciting services
  • Being underage.

Being reported, fairly or not, can flag your account. Tind relies on an automated system, and accounts may be banned without human review. 

Tind disables banned accounts completely, blocks login access, and often blacklists the device, which is why reinstalling the app alone rarely works.

Tind is owned by Match Group, so bans extend to other Match-owned apps.

What the Tind Appeal Centre Is and How It Works

The Appeal Centre is Tind’s official hub for appealing bans and warnings, and it is the first and only place you should go if you want a ban fixed.

To access it, visit the Tind Appeal Center in a browser and log in using your account’s number or email. Apple ID, Google, or Facebook also work if linked.

But not all bans appear in the portal. Tind only lists redeemable ones, usually from the last 6 months. If you do not see your ban, it means:

  • The ban is older than six months
  • The ban was already appealed
  • Tind marked it as non-appealable

You get one appeal per ban. If it is denied, Tind will not allow another appeal for the same action. Your ban status is tracked and shows up as the following:

  • ⌛ In Review
  • ✅ Approved (account restored)
  • ❌ Denied (decision is final)

Glitches are common, and some never see their bans listed. Others see an appeal marked Approved, but their account remains banned.

How to Write a Successful Tind Ban Appeal

The most successful Tind ban appeals are calm, clear, and factual. Don’t show anger, or make accusations and threats, as they always work against you. 

If you unknowingly broke a rule, admit it and explain how you will avoid it in the future. If something was misinterpreted, clarify the context.

If you know what you did, own up to your actions and promise to correct your behavior in the future.

If you believe you were revenge-reported, mention the possibility in your appeal, and the history between you and that match. Follow this structure:

1. State the situation clearly
“My account was recently banned, and I would like to appeal this decision.”

2. Explain why it appears to be a mistake
“I have reviewed the guidelines and do not believe I violated them. If something was misinterpreted, I would appreciate the chance to clarify.”

3. Show good faith and accountability
“I have always tried to use Tind responsibly and will continue to follow the rules if my account is restored.”

How Long Does a Tind Appeal Take?

Tind ban appeals take a few days or weeks. If you receive no response after 10-14 days, send one polite follow-up through Tind’s Help page.

Manage your expectations. Just because you appeal a ban doesn’t mean Tind will reverse it or even acknowledge your appeal.

In Europe, GDPR laws give stronger rights to challenge automated decisions like bans, so EU users may have an easier time, even though Tind does not confirm this publicly.

📩 Check your Spam Folder. Many users miss replies because Tind’s emails land in spam folders, leaving appeals unanswered.

Keep copies of your appeal and responses. It helps if you later escalate the issue to consumer protection bodies such as the Better Business Bureau.

Can You Contact Tind Outside the Appeal Centre?

You can submit a request through Tind’s Help form by choosing “Trouble with account login” and then “My account was banned”. 

Include the email and number tied to the account, explain what happened calmly, acknowledge any mistakes if relevant, and attach screenshots.

You can also try to email Tind via their official email addresses, though they usually generate automated replies.

Tind lists a phone number as well (214-853-4309), but they rarely pick up or do more than redirect users back to online forms.

What Happens After You Appeal a Tind Ban

After submitting an appeal, Tind might reinstate your account if they decide the ban was wrong. The account is usually restored with little explanation.

On the flip side, Tind may uphold the ban if they believe it was justified. In this case, they typically say the decision is final and refuse to elaborate.

Appeals are more likely to work when you did not violate crucial rules, and you remain respectful, especially if it’s your first ban and you take accountability.

However, if the ban was clearly justified, your tone is aggressive, and you repeatedly exploit Tind’s systems, the chances of the appeal working drop.

Try external pressure. File a complaint with the BBB. In some cases, it pushes Tind to respond more seriously, occasionally leading to reversals.

Mentions of GDPR and CCPA laws help a little, especially when requesting account deletion, which is very useful when creating new Tind accounts.

FAQs: Appealing a Tind Ban 

1. Can I get unbanned from Tind?
If the ban was a mistake or based on a misinterpretation, an appeal through the Appeal Center can work. If the ban was justified, reversals are rare, and Tind often treats the decision as final.

2. How long is a Tind ban?
Most bans are usually permanent unless approved. Tind does not provide fixed ban durations, and some have lasted years.

3. How long does a Tind ban appeal take?
Some users hear back within a few days, while others wait weeks or even months. After 10-14 days of silence, send one polite follow-up.

4. Can I use a VPN to bypass a Tind ban?
A VPN alone does not bypass a Tind ban because it tracks devices, phone numbers, and account data, not just IP addresses.
